Related Insights (AI question prompts)
Related Insights are AI-generated question prompts that surface alongside metric tiles — short, clickable questions like “Why did refunds spike last week?” or “Which campaigns drove the AOV increase?”. Selecting a prompt loads a drilldown or filter that answers the question without further configuration.
Related Insights are gated by the Consent for AI Features setting on the workspace.
Opting in
Section titled “Opting in”Related Insights only render when Consent for AI Features is on. The setting lives in Settings → Workspace and is workspace-scoped — flipping it on enables AI features for everyone in the workspace.
Until consent is granted, the Related Insights panel is hidden across every dashboard. Tiles render exactly as they would otherwise; nothing about the standard view changes.

Where they appear
Section titled “Where they appear”Related Insights surface in three places:
| Surface | What appears |
|---|---|
| Below a metric tile on Brand Overview or Explore | 2–4 question prompts contextual to the tile’s metric and current period |
| In the ℹ️ panel of a tile | Prompts that probe the metric’s definition or recent movement |
| At the bottom of a Report section | Prompts specific to the section’s metric mix |
Each prompt is short (a sentence or two). Clicking opens a drilldown, filter, or related dashboard — never a chat interface.
What the prompts cover
Section titled “What the prompts cover”Prompts are generated from the metric, the date range, the comparison, and recent movement. Typical patterns:
- Movement-explanatory — “Why did Net Sales drop 12% week-over-week?”
- Contributor-discovery — “Which products drove the AOV increase?”
- Cross-platform — “Did the Meta spend cut affect blended ROAS?”
- Anomaly-spotting — “Refund rate exceeded its 90-day average — what caused it?”
Prompts are generated fresh on each dashboard load; the same metric on the same date range can produce different prompts in different visits.
What the AI can and can’t see
Section titled “What the AI can and can’t see”Related Insights run against the same data the dashboard already has — orders, campaigns, products, ad performance. The AI does not have access to:
- The contents of customer profiles or PII beyond what aggregated metrics expose.
- External data not connected via an integration.
- Other workspaces’ data.
The AI does see metric values, date ranges, and metric definitions for the current workspace. See Managing your workspace for the full data-handling notes on AI Features.
Common questions
Section titled “Common questions”Related Insights don’t appear, but Consent for AI Features is on. Confirm the setting was saved (the toggle is workspace-wide and may need an admin to flip it). If consent is on and prompts still don’t appear, try a different metric tile — prompts require enough recent movement to be relevant; a flat metric may render none.
Can prompts be disabled per user? No. Prompts are workspace-wide. To suppress them, flip Consent for AI Features off.
The prompt I clicked didn’t answer the question. Prompts route to a drilldown or filter that’s typically a good starting point, not always a final answer. Use the drilldown’s own controls (Group By, date range, filters) to keep exploring.
